谷歌云代理商:为什么谷歌云Dataflow Streaming Engine提升实时处理?
一、谷歌云Dataflow Streaming Engine的核心优势
谷歌云Dataflow Streaming Engine是谷歌云平台(GCP)提供的全托管式流数据处理服务,基于Apache Beam模型构建,专为实时数据处理场景优化。其核心优势包括:
- 无服务器架构:自动管理计算资源,用户无需关注底层基础设施。
- 水平扩展能力:根据数据流量动态调整资源,支持每秒百万级事件处理。
- 精确一次处理语义(Exactly-Once):确保数据在传输和处理过程中不丢失或重复。
- 与谷歌云生态深度集成:无缝对接Pub/Sub、BigQuery等GCP服务。
二、实时处理性能提升的关键技术
1. 智能分片(Dynamic Work Rebalancing)
Dataflow Streaming Engine通过实时监控数据分片负载,动态调整任务分配,避免因数据倾斜导致的延迟。例如,当某个分片处理速度下降时,系统会自动将部分数据迁移到空闲节点。
2. 低延迟水印机制(Watermarks)
通过预测数据到达时间的算法,准确判断窗口触发时机,即使在网络波动情况下也能最小化延迟。实际测试显示,相比传统Spark Streaming,延迟可降低60%以上。
3. 增量处理优化
支持对持续到达的数据进行微批次(Micro-batch)处理,每次处理仅计算增量部分。某电商案例显示,该技术使促销期间的实时用户行为分析响应时间从15秒缩短至2秒。
三、与其他云服务的协同效应
| 关联服务 | 协同价值 | 典型应用场景 |
|---|---|---|
| Cloud Pub/Sub | 作为高吞吐量消息队列,支持每秒百万级消息摄入 | IoT设备数据实时采集 |
| BigQuery | 处理结果直接写入分析型数据库 | 实时仪表盘更新 |
| Cloud ML Engine | 流式数据实时输入机器学习模型 | 欺诈交易即时检测 |
四、行业应用案例验证
案例1:金融风控系统
某国际银行采用Dataflow Streaming Engine后,信用卡欺诈检测的响应时间从分钟级降至800毫秒,同时通过自动扩展应对了交易高峰期的300%流量增长。
案例2:游戏玩家分析
一家移动游戏公司将玩家行为数据实时处理后,结合BigQuery ML实现动态难度调整,使玩家留存率提升22%,数据处理成本反而降低40%。

五、与传统方案的对比优势
- 运维成本:相比自建Kafka+Flink集群,管理开销减少70%
- 可靠性:谷歌骨干网络保障99.99%的服务可用性
- 功能完整性:内置数据去重、窗口函数等20+流处理算子
总结
谷歌云Dataflow Streaming Engine通过其独特的动态资源调度、精确状态管理和深度生态集成,为企业提供了具备生产级可靠性的实时数据处理解决方案。无论是应对突发流量、降低处理延迟,还是实现复杂事件处理逻辑,其表现均显著优于传统方案。对于需要快速从数据中获取实时洞察的企业而言,选择具备谷歌云代理商资质的服务伙伴实施Dataflow Streaming Engine,将成为数字化转型中的关键加速器。

kf@jusoucn.com
4008-020-360


4008-020-360
